San Diego’s vote to end city manager post may have been a mistake – San Diego Union-Tribune

My family has lived in San Diego since 1985. Each year policies are passed which erode our city with no solutions from the Mayor’s Office. Once we had a city manager. In 2006, San Diego voters passed Proposition F, which changed the city’s council/manager form of government. I recall this being called a switch from weak mayor to strong mayor. Well, now it seems we have a weak mayor and no city manager. Perhaps this was an error in judgment as city operations seemed to go downhill from there. Someone with management experience, who does not answer to the mayor, might make a significant difference. Please consider reinstating the position of city manager.

— Kathleen K. Edwards, Bankers Hill
